Pre обозначает предварительно отформатированный текст
Http://ideone.com/m0vrCg
Можно скомпилировать и проверить на этом сайте
Ответ:
2) 00101101
Объяснение:
45₁₀ = 101101₂
Добавим слева нули до длины 8 цифр: 00101101
#include <iostream>
using namespace std;
int main()
{
unsigned n;
cin >> n;
if (n > 0) {
for (int i = 2; i <= n; i += 2) {
cout << i << " ";
}
}
return 0;
}
#include <iostream>
int main(){<span>
unsigned int m = 0;
</span><span> std::cin >> m;
</span><span>
int * c = new int[m];
</span><span> int * t = new int[m];
</span><span> for (unsigned int i = 0,n = 0; i < m; ++i) {
</span><span> std::cin >> c[i];
</span><span> (c[i] > 0) ? t[n++] = c[i]: t[m-(i-n)-1] = c[i];
</span><span> }</span>
<span>
for (unsigned int i = 0; i < m; ++i)</span><span> std::cout << c[i] << ',';</span><span /><span>
std::cout << std::endl;</span><span>
for (unsigned int i = 0; i < m; ++i) </span><span>std::cout << t[i] << ',';</span><span />
<span> delete c;
</span><span> delete t;
</span><span> return 0;
</span><span>}</span>